Real-time driver awareness

Bilingual alerts before the risk zone, not after.

The NomadStick delivers audio alerts to the driver in real time — before entering a school zone, before a speed limit changes, before crossing a provincial boundary. Alerts are bilingual EN/FR and driver-selectable. The language preference takes effect on the next ignition cycle.

Drivers are not surprised by enforcement. They are warned in advance. The system is designed to help compliant drivers stay compliant — not to catch them failing.

School zone ahead

Audio alert fires before the school zone boundary. Schedule-aware — active only during school hours.

Speed limit change

Zone-aware speed enforcement with warning, violation, and stunt tiers. Local lookup — no cloud required.

Compliance reminder

Registration, inspection, and licence expiry reminders delivered to the driver before the expiry date.

Provincial boundary

Alert on entry to a new province. Relevant for cross-border commercial and government deployments.

The blackbox principle

Every event recorded. Every record signed.

When an incident occurs, the NomadStick has already recorded everything. Speed, location, direction, compliance state, alerts received, and the driver's response — all structured, signed at the edge, and retrievable. The record exists before anyone asks for it.

Street View context

Every violation is geo-located to a real road position. The operator sees a Street View image of the exact location where the incident occurred.

Intercept map

A precise intercept map shows the vehicle's position, direction of travel, and the exact point of the violation — structured for enforcement response.

Structured record

Reference code, timestamp, speed vs limit, overage amount, driver identity, vehicle linkage, and compliance state — all in one retrievable evidence record.

New Brunswick — April 2026

Physical registration stickers eliminated. Electronic monitoring is now essential.

The Government of New Brunswick eliminated physical vehicle registration stickers as of April 1, 2026. Registration status is now verified electronically only. Velantra's continuous compliance monitoring is the only scalable method to track registration status across the vehicle population without a roadside stop.

Driver risk intelligence

Objective scoring. No assumptions.

The Velantra risk engine scores every driver using confirmed telemetry and backend-calculated evidence — not profiling, assumptions, or demographic inference.

The risk index runs from 0 to 100. Higher scores indicate greater driving risk.

Each score is built from independently calculated components including speeding severity, excessive speeding exposure, sustained high RPM, hard acceleration, and harsh braking.

LOW 0-20MILD 21-40MEDIUM 41-70HIGH 71-100
Example risk breakdown — active pilot data

Each category is measured independently. Backend logic weights category contributions into a single risk index.
